The cotton ball in the mouth after tooth extraction can usually be spit out in 30~40 minutes. After tooth extraction will be left in the mouth a large socket, some of the buried teeth also need to be cut and flap extraction, blood-rich mouth, there will be a certain amount of bleeding in the alveolar fossa, generally bite the cotton ball to stop bleeding. Generally after tooth extraction, bite a cotton ball for 30 minutes, will form a blood clot in the alveolar fossa, so as to achieve the purpose of hemostasis, if spit out the cotton ball and a certain amount of bleeding, you can bite the cotton ball for a while to an hour, and hemostasis, generally in the cotton ball spit out, there will be a small amount of blood seepage in the mouth within two to three days is a normal phenomenon, avoid brushing and rinsing within 24 hours, to avoid the shedding of blood clots caused by secondary hemorrhage. Spit out the cotton ball after 30-60 minutes after tooth extraction, if the wound bleeding is large, you need to consult a doctor in a timely manner, under the guidance of the doctor to check and deal with, to avoid adverse consequences.
